What this means for learners
Daur and Kharia share 15 sounds — roughly 26% of Kharia's inventory overlaps with Daur. Shared sounds are ones a speaker already knows from their native language and will generally produce and perceive accurately without explicit training.
The 32 sounds found only in Kharia represent the greatest pronunciation challenge for Daur speakers. The adult brain tends to map unfamiliar sounds onto the closest native equivalent — a process that produces the characteristic "accent" of a second-language speaker. Learning to hear and produce these sounds as distinct requires focused ear training, not just repetition.
Conversely, Daur has 42 sounds not used in Kharia. Native Kharia speakers learning Daur will face the mirror-image challenge with these sounds.
Phoneme inventories from PHOIBLE. Data reflects one documented inventory per language; some variation exists across dialects and sources.
